Empowering Developers: The Rise of Low-Code Platforms
In an era where speed and agility are paramount, especially for startups and solopreneurs, low-code platforms have emerged as a game-changer. These tools empower individuals and teams to build applications without the traditional coding knowledge, significantly cutting down the cost and time required to bring new products to market. But how exactly do these platforms solve real-world challenges? Let’s dive into the practical applications and benefits of low-code solutions.
The story of low-code platforms begins with the common challenges faced by startups and non-technical builders: high development costs and long timelines. For a startup, every dollar spent and every minute wasted can mean the difference between success and failure. Traditional development often involves hiring skilled developers, which can be prohibitively expensive and time-consuming.
Low-code platforms like Bubble, Retool, and Softr change the narrative by enabling even non-developers to create functional applications rapidly. These platforms offer drag-and-drop interfaces, pre-built templates, and integrations that allow users to focus on functionality rather than code. For example, a solopreneur could build a minimum viable product (MVP) in a matter of days instead of months, test it with real users, and iterate based on feedback without needing to touch a single line of code.
Consider the case of a small startup aiming to disrupt the local food delivery market. With a limited budget, they turned to Bubble to build their MVP. Using Bubble’s visual editor, they quickly prototyped their app, integrating features like user authentication, order management, and payment processing. The team could focus on refining their business model and customer experience instead of being bogged down by development hurdles. This approach not only saved them tens of thousands of dollars but also allowed them to launch in record time, gaining a competitive edge in the market.
Bubble is known for its user-friendly interface and powerful backend capabilities. It allows users to design responsive web applications using a visual editor. One standout feature of Bubble is its ability to handle complex logic and workflows, making it ideal for building sophisticated applications.

Retool is tailored for building internal tools quickly. It connects to databases and APIs, allowing users to create dashboards and admin panels without extensive coding.

Softr specializes in turning Airtable data into functional web apps. It’s perfect for non-developers looking to leverage data without deep technical skills.

The convergence of low-code platforms and AI is an exciting frontier. AI can enhance low-code applications by providing advanced analytics, personalized user experiences, and intelligent automation. However, there is still skepticism among traditional developers about the robustness and scalability of low-code solutions. Bridging this gap requires continuous improvement in platform capabilities and a shift in mindset towards embracing new technologies.
